About the Role
We are seeking a commercially astute and strategic Portfolio Revenue Manager to drive revenue performance across a diverse portfolio of luxury properties in Cape Town. This role is responsible for developing and executing revenue strategies that maximise profitability, ensure market competitiveness, and align with overarching business objectives.
Key Responsibilities
- Develop; implement, and oversee comprehensive revenue management strategies across all properties
- Analyse market trends, competitor activity, and demand patterns to inform pricing decisions
- Drive dynamic pricing strategies to optimise revenue across all segments
- Conduct detailed market analysis and competitive benchmarking
- Lead weekly and monthly performance reviews for each property
- Monitor and analyse key metrics including ADR, RevPAR, and occupancy
- Provide actionable insights and strategic recommendations to General Managers and stakeholders
- Develop accurate forecasts and annual budgets for each property
- Analyse long-term trends to anticipate future demand
- Adjust strategies based on performance variances and evolving market conditions
- Partner with marketing teams to align campaigns with revenue objectives
- Support group and event sales through strategic pricing and yield management
- Negotiate and manage agreements with OTAs, wholesalers, and distribution partners
- Present performance reports and strategic recommendations to senior leadership
- Mentor and guide the Distribution Manager, Support Coordinator, and Revenue Interns
- Lead regular revenue and strategy meetings with property teams
- Foster a high-performance, collaborative culture across the portfolio
Requirements
- Proven experience in a senior revenue management role within hospitality (multi-property exposure preferred)
- Strong analytical skills with the ability to interpret data and translate into strategy
- In-depth understanding of revenue management systems, distribution channels, and market dynamics
- Excellent communication and stakeholder management skills
- Ability to thrive in a fast-paced, high-performance environment

About Other IT/Computer Jobs in Western Cape
The Western Cape, situated on the south coast of South Africa, is home to a thriving IT industry that offers a diverse range of career opportunities for professionals with expertise in various fields.
The job market in the Western Cape is highly competitive, with many major companies and startups operating in the region. The province’s strategic location, combined with its well-developed infrastructure, makes it an attractive hub for businesses looking to establish themselves in Africa. As a result, there is a high demand for skilled IT professionals who can support the growth of these companies.
The average salary ranges for IT professionals in the Western Cape are as follows: software engineers and developers can expect to earn between R800 000 to R1 200 000 per annum; data scientists and analysts can range from R600 000 to R900 000; cybersecurity specialists can earn anywhere from R500 000 to R800 000; and IT project managers can command salaries ranging from R400 000 to R700 000. These figures are based on industry standards and may vary depending on factors such as experience, qualifications, and company size.
To succeed in an IT career in the Western Cape, professionals need to possess a range of key skills, including programming languages (Java, Python, C++), data structures and algorithms, software development methodologies, cloud computing (AWS, Azure, Google Cloud), cybersecurity principles, and excellent communication skills. Additionally, knowledge of industry-specific tools and technologies, such as SAP or Oracle, can be highly valued.
Several major companies and industries are actively hiring IT professionals in the Western Cape. For example, tech giants like IBM and Dell have a strong presence in the region, while financial institutions such as Standard Bank and First National Bank also have significant IT departments. The automotive industry is another major sector that employs IT professionals, with companies like Toyota and Volkswagen having operations in the province.
Career growth opportunities are plentiful for IT professionals in the Western Cape, with many companies offering training and development programs to help employees upskill and reskill. With experience, professionals can move into senior roles such as technical lead or manager, or transition into related fields like business analysis or consulting. The region’s entrepreneurial spirit also makes it an ideal location for startups, providing opportunities for IT professionals to launch their own businesses or join innovative companies that are shaping the future of technology.
